Scripps Local Media suspends programming on 54 of its local broadcast stations in 36 Nielsen-designated market areas, beginning at 7 p.m. ET on Sunday, after a retransmission dispute with DirecTV. The blackout affects DirecTV services including streaming, satellite, and U-verse, according to reporting and a company notice. Both sides say the impasse is driven by retransmission rate demands. DirecTV and Scripps each attribute responsibility for the blackout to the other, with DirecTV describing the standoff as occurring around major upcoming events. Coverage notes the timing falls just before multiple state and local primary elections in June, as well as upcoming NBA-related programming. Scripps also characterizes its position as seeking consent rates at the highest level. The dispute has led to the stations going dark, with the parties not reaching an agreement by the start of the suspension window.
